How to Play Without Internet

  1. Open the game once while online: This lets the browser cache assets.
  2. Add to Home Screen / Install: If prompted, install the web app for better offline support.
  3. Test offline: Turn on Airplane Mode and relaunch the game from your Home Screen.
  4. Note: Not every game supports full offline; look for the “Offline-ready” badge on game pages.

Troubleshooting

  • Game won’t open offline? Revisit once online to refresh the cache, then try again.
  • Slow or laggy? Close extra tabs, disable heavy extensions, or use a modern browser.
  • Blocked at school/work? Access depends on local network policies; please follow rules.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are “no internet games”?

They are lightweight browser games designed to work with poor connections and, in some cases, offline after the first load.

Do these games really work without Wi-Fi?

Many titles are offline-friendly once opened online at least once. Support varies by game — look for the “Offline-ready” badge.

Do I need to download anything?

No. Games run in modern browsers. Some offer an optional “Install”/“Add to Home Screen” to enhance offline play.

Are no internet games unblocked?

Many are, but network rules vary. If a title is blocked, try another game or play on a different network.

More Frequently Asked Questions

Which games use the least data?

Card games (Solitaire), logic puzzles (Sudoku, Minesweeper), and 2048 are typically low-data.

Can I play on mobile?

Yes. The site supports modern mobile browsers, and some titles can be added to your Home Screen for offline access.

Why did offline stop working?

Clearing browser data or updating the game can remove cached files. Revisit the game online to recache.

Is progress saved?

Many games use local storage for highscores/settings on your device. Clearing site data resets progress.
